Does my spouse have to file bankruptcy if I file?
Oct 14, 2011
No!your spouse does not have to file bankruptcy along with you if he or she does not want to.You can file alone if you wish without your spouse becoming part of the bankruptcy at all.

Where can I get my credit report and how much will it cost?
Oct 12, 2011
Good news! It's free! But don't go anywhere that say "free credit report" and expect a free report with no strings attached. The proper place to go is annualcreditreport.com. This is the site that the ...
